🚗 Light Up Your Journey with Style!
These For F150 LED Fog Lights are designed for 2006-2014 F150 models, 2008-2011 Ford Ranger, and 2007-2015 Ford Expedition. Featuring a dual-color function, they allow you to switch between 6000K white and 3000K amber light. With a plug-and-play installation, durable construction, and high-performance LED chips, these fog lights enhance visibility and style while ensuring longevity.

Great lighs! New version fixed radio interference
Great lights and lenses, bright and well made and good looking product and good value. Installed on my 2008 Ranger, pretty easy just needed to trim some plastic from the factory mounting ring to clear the ear on the light housing and reverse polarity on the connectors. The first version I got came on white initially and toggle to yellow, but it caused fm radio interference. Customer service was very responsive and sent me an updated version of the product direct with a "new chip". I reinstalled the new one and it comes on yellow initially and fixes the radio interference. So I'm stoked!

Default Color is YELLOW, not white, as described
I've got to say, I really like these fog lights. I installed them in my 2014 F150, and they were a direct replacement and perfect fit. To install these lights, you need to remove the fog light housing (three bolts behind the bumper), then you can replace the Fog light assembly with this new one. The springs that came with this kit were to long for my setup, so I used my OEM springs and screws with this install. The passenger side was the most difficult to replace (but easiest to align) due to the location of one bolt.These lights shine nice and bright and were a great upgrade to the stock fog light assemblies and bulbs. I noticed the light pattern on these are different between Yellow and White. White has more of a straight-line cut off, like you'd see with projector lights. The yellow points higher and has a larger spread of light than the white does. If you adjust it just right, the white really lightens up the area directly in front of your vehicle (as it should), and the yellow reaches just below where your low beams are, which really helps with visibility without blinding on-coming traffic.The Yellow on these are actually a really good shade, too. I personally think it makes it easier to see details in the road when weather conditions turn poor.There's only one complaint I have with these. They are advertised as white being the default mode/color, which is what I was wanting, but instead these default to yellow. I prefer to use white 90% of the time for daily (nightly?) driving and just flip on the yellows when driving through rain, dust, fog, snow, etc. So unfortunately, I find myself turning off and on my fog lights nearly every time I get in my truck to drive, so I can switch it to white, my preferred main color.If you install these fog lights, I'd also recommend enabling "bambi mode" with FORscan on your truck. This mode keeps your fog lights on when your high beams turn on. If you don't enable this mode, your fog lights will change color every time you turn on/off your high beams or flash your high beams.Overall, I'd give these fog lights 4 stars. I honestly really want to give them 5 stars because the build quality is actually really good and the lights work really well, but I'm really disappointed that the default color is yellow instead of white, as it was advertised. I would easily change my rating to 5 star if this product operated as described.Would I recommend them? If you want yellow as your default and white as your secondary color, I would 100% recommend this upgrade. They really are a good set of lights and seem much more well built than OEM. Just take your time aligning them and you'll be happy with the results!
